How much do remote computer jobs pay per hour?

As of Aug 9, 2026, the average hourly pay for remote computer in Indianapolis, IN is $19.93,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$16.78 and $22.31 per hour,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a remote computer support specialist?

To thrive as a Remote Computer Support Specialist, you need a strong understanding of computer hardware, networking, troubleshooting, and typically a relevant certification such as CompTIA A+ or Microsoft Certified: Modern Desktop Administrator Associate. Familiarity with remote access tools, ticketing systems, and diagnostic software is essential for efficiently resolving technical issues. Excellent communication, patience, and problem-solving abilities help you effectively assist users and manage stressful situations. These skills ensure timely and accurate support, boosting productivity and user satisfaction in a remote work environment.

What are some common challenges faced by professionals working in a remote computer support role, and how can they be addressed?

One common challenge in a remote computer support role is troubleshooting technical issues without physical access to the user's device, which can make problem-solving more complex. Clear communication skills are essential for guiding users through solutions and accurately diagnosing issues remotely. Additionally, working from home may sometimes lead to feelings of isolation, so it's important to stay connected with teammates through regular virtual meetings and collaboration tools. Staying organized and following structured workflows also helps in tracking multiple support tickets efficiently.

What is the difference between Remote Computer vs Remote Network Technician?

AspectRemote ComputerRemote Network Technician
CredentialsCompTIA A+, Microsoft certificationsCompTIA Network+, Cisco CCNA
Work EnvironmentRemote support for individual users and small businessesRemote troubleshooting of network infrastructure and connectivity
Industry UsageIT support, help desk, tech servicesNetwork administration, infrastructure management

Remote Computer roles focus on supporting individual computers and software issues remotely, often requiring certifications like CompTIA A+ and working in help desk environments. Remote Network Technicians specialize in network systems, requiring certifications like Cisco CCNA, and handle network connectivity and infrastructure remotely. While both roles are IT-focused and often work remotely, their technical scope and certifications differ, aligning with their specific responsibilities.

Mainframe Support Operator / Administrator (Remote)

A.C. Coy

Indianapolis, IN • Remote

Other

Re-posted 16 days ago


Job description

Overview
  • Tier One Technologies is seeking a Mainframe Support Operator/Administrator to work with our US Government client.
  • This will be a 100% remote Contract-to-Hire position.
  • Must be a US Citizen.
  • SELECTED CANDIDATES WITHOUT REQUIRED CLEARANCE WILL BE SUBJECT TO A FEDERAL GOVERNMENT BACKGROUND INVESTIGATION TO RECEIVE IT.
Responsibilities
  • Responsible for supporting a large mainframe payroll application.
  • Operate, monitor, and assist in the maintenance and integrity of the mainframe, peripherals, servers, and network.  
  • Participate in Disaster Recovery and provided first level help desk support.
  • Able to adapt to various operational duties in customized data centers.
  • Maintain smooth operation of multi-user computer systems, including coordination with network engineers.
  • Perform systems security administration functions.
  • Other duties may include maintaining system documentation, system performance, and installing system wide software.
  • Develop and monitor policies and standards for allocation related to the use of computing resources.
  • Interact with users.
Qualifications
  • Prior relevant experience in the IBM mainframe environment.
  • Excellent troubleshooting and communication skills.
  • Must be a US Citizen (no dual citizenship).
  • Ability to obtain DoD Public Trust clearance.
  • Must not have traveled outside the US for a combined total of 6 months or more in the last 5 years.
  • Must have resided in the US for the last 5 years.
